Latest newsLeading air compressors blowing "green" airCompressed air matters to industry. Its primary but hidden cost is energy consumption, which costs as much as 80% of the total life cost of the compressor. Therefore, efficiency in compressed air systems has a significant impact on costs and on the environment. CAAA speaks at the MEPSA Conference in SydneyJulia Beck from the CAAA spoke at the MEPSA (Motor Energy Performance Standards Australia) Conference in Sydney. The topic of the presentation was "Air Compressor Efficiency - a voluntary program in New Zealand". The purpose of the presentation was to outline an energy efficiency programme developed by the New Zealand Electricity Commission.
